9 Tips for Improving Your Credit Score

Drumroll please….

1. Review your current credit report for accuracy. Everyone is entitled to one free credit report per year from each of the three credit bureaus—Experian, Equifax, and TransUnion. Get a copy of your credit report and look at it for accuracy. First, make sure that the information in your file is about you and only you, not someone who has a similar name or a similar Social Security number. It is very common for your credit reports to have mistakes or incorrect information. At a minimum, make sure that the information you are being evaluated on is current and correct
.
2. Fix credit report mistakes. If you find something on your credit report that is incorrect or missing, you should dispute the mistake by contacting the credit bureaus directly. All credit bureaus have their dispute procedures on their website. They are also required by law to investigate any disputed items and these investigations will usually be done within 30 days of your request.



3. Pay your bills on time. Sounds like a no-brainer, right? Payment history accounts for roughly 35% of your credit score. Paying bills on time is the most important thing to do. If you’re struggling to catch up, contact your creditors to work out a payment schedule.


4. Increase the length of your credit history. This accounts for about 15% of your score. Don’t cancel your old card or get a lot of new ones in a short time span because this can hurt your score.
5. Keep credit card balances low. It’s a good idea to keep the balances below 25% of your available credit. Even if you pay off your credit cards every month, a high average balance will impact your score. This accounts for about 30% of your credit score.


6. Keep new credit requests to a minimum. This accounts for 10% of your score. Every time a lender runs your credit, an inquiry is recorded. If you are trying to get a loan, don’t apply for new credit cards first. DO NOT..I repeat..DO NOT open store accounts to get that 1 time 15% discount.


7. Be aware that paying off a collection account will not remove it from your credit report. It will stay on your report for seven years. I know..it doesn’t seem fair..but…


8. Pay off debt rather than moving it around. The most effective way to improve your credit score in this area is by paying down your revolving credit. In fact, owing the same amount but having fewer open accounts may lower your score.


9. Beware credit-repair scams. By all means, don’t pay someone to wipe away the negative items in your file. If they don’t follow through, the damaging items will reappear in two or three months. It just takes a little bit of your time and follow through.

WHAT'S THE LATEST IN HOME PRODUCTS


COOL STUFF TO CHECK OUT..NEW WEBSITE COMING FOR HOMEOWNERS IN FEBRUARY..HOUSELOGIC.COM

Hot Home Products for 2010




Hot home products for 2010 include peel-and stick innovations, dynamic new paint concepts, valuable entry door/security solutions, affordable designer treatments for ceilings, an easy way to save water with new green technology, and a classic phone zapper that gives telemarketers the boot, says home improvement “What’s New Guru” Don Logay.

Among Logay’s recent finds and all-time favorites:

One2Flush™ Dual Flush Conversion Kit
: The One2Flush™ toilet conversion kit turns a standard water-guzzling tank-type toilet into an eco-friendly, high-efficiency, water-saving dual flush model. One2Flush—with its “half flush for liquids and full flush for solids”—reduces water use by more than 38% and can save an average family over 10% on monthly water bills. Fits all standard 2-piece toilets, 1.6 gallon flush and up. Available nationwide at most hardware stores (Ace, True Value, Do-It-Best). For more information, visit www.one2flush.com.

Dead Bolt Secure™ Entry Lock Protection
: The Dead Bolt Secure™ offers a low-cost, ingenious solution that makes standard deadbolt locks (with a lever or twist-type inside handle) virtually pick-proof. It even blocks entry for anyone with a legitimate key. How? A simple spring-loaded device that installs in minutes flips down to prevent a dead bolt’s handle form turning—no matter how it is being unlocked. Offered in brass and satin nickel. The best part? It only costs $9.95. Order online at www.arclink.net.

Would of , Could of, Should have……


Don’t let this be YOU! Today’s real estate market has some of the best buying opportunities that we have seen in years!

1. Current inventory levels and prices are stabilizing plus there are historically low interest rates.

2. Don’t forget the home buyer’s tax credit that has been expanded to include homeowners that have lived in the same principal residence for any five consecutive-year period during the eight year period that ended on the date the replacement home is purchased. THERE ARE ONLY 142 MORE DAYS TO CLAIM YOUR CREDIT!

3. Housing remains an excellent long term investment. The median price for a home is Illinois in 2008 was 23% higher than it was in 1998 (10 years!)

4. It pays to own versus rent! A typical homeowner’s net worth is 49 times that of a renter’s according to the National Association of Realtors®.

5. Sellers can recoup on the buy side! To sell quickly in today’s market make sure your home has a compelling price not just a comparable one. You know my saying “This is not brain surgery people!” PRICE IT RIGHT!!!!
What a seller may lose on the sell side can be more than recovered on the buy side.
